The Lintwarden scanner job failed on the nightly run because the typo-squatting ruleset cache was stale after the mirror rotation at Verrick Systems. Re-running with a cold cache fixed it, so no code change is needed in this PR. For verification, compare against the passing build whose trace token is recorded below.

session token of tajef-bageg = htk21_5d90d574934f3ccae6437

Board summary for Quarrow & Fenn. Proposed budget: up 6%. Drivers: mandatory audit-readiness courses, the Silverbeck analytics programme, and first-line manager training at the Marlow Cross site. Cuts: external conferences, duplicate vendor subscriptions. Owner: Edda Varis, head of people development. Approval sought at the March sitting; deferral pushes the Silverbeck cohort to autumn. Contingency reserve held at 5% of the total. Figures assume flat headcount. The assumptions rest on the confidential plan noted immediately below.

board note of yaduf-hahip: Only 5 of the 80 pilot accounts renewed Ulaath, so a churn review is set for April 1.

Q: How do new starters get into the prototype workshop on Level 2?

A: The workshop is a restricted fabrication area, so access is not granted automatically with your standard staff badge. First, complete the machine-safety induction run by the Workshop Stewards every Tuesday morning. Once you have passed, your badge will be activated for the outer door within two working days. The inner tool-cage door uses a separate keypad, and the code changes quarterly. For the current quarter, use the entry code shown below.

staff pass of kawip-hawef = bdg-QLP-2